2020 BDT to ISK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2020

During 2020, the BDT to ISK ex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on May 6, valuing the pair at 1.7347.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on January 1, dropping to 1.4186.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.3161 ISK.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 1.4554 to the December average rate of 1.5023, the exchange rate registered a net change of 3.22%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2020 high of 1.7347 was up 14.90% compared to the 2019 peak of 1.5097,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.
